All three are non-canon to the Zelda franchise. Faces of Evil, Wand of Gamelon, and Zelda's Adventure were created after Philips secured the rights to use Nintendo characters in CD-i games. They received little funding and development time, with Nintendo providing only cursory input.Why is Hyrule Warriors not canon?

The term Canon refers to the source material of a given series. In the Legend of Zelda series, as well as the rest of fiction, the term refers to anything which has been established as fact by official sources, most particularly the games themselves and their manuals.What games are canon to Botw?

Does Phantom Hourglass take place after Wind Waker?
Timeline PlacementThe game is set after the events of The Wind Waker, which makes it the second confirmed entry in the Adult Timeline. It is followed 100 years later by Spirit Tracks, which is situated in a new land that was discovered eventually by Link, Tetra and her pirate crew.
